Transaction 866489ac85078c0397177d81dfa5b7c7402eca89206f15f4b42a96ef377bddf0
1 Input
1 Output
-
866489ac85078c0397177d81dfa5b7c7402eca89206f15f4b42a96ef377bddf0:0
- value
- 1108248
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6c23039ce46bfc80a61b6c5016439d6e8c6311ec O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ArmvYNYqKmoknyydUvJyGto5hwcUfsksN